The campaign “Make a face at pediatric cancer” is back at IGA

From May 28 to June 17, 2026, the Fondation Charles-Bruneau and IGA are once again joining forces for the “Make a face at pediatric cancer” campaign.

For the second year in a row, customers at IGA stores in Quebec and New Brunswick, Dépanneurs Voisin, and Voilà by IGA are invited to support the cause by purchasing a blue lollipop for $2 plus tax.

The profits from the campaign will be donated to the Fondation Charles-Bruneau to support pediatric hematology-oncology research and care in Quebec.

A campaign that brings people together

Once again this year, five young ambassadors are lending their smiles and personalities to the campaign: Emma-Ève, Kingston, Ève, Logan, and Zoé. Their presence reminds us that behind every donation are real children, families facing the challenges of illness, and medical advances made possible by research.

Beyond fundraising, this initiative also raises public awareness about pediatric cancer while creating a positive and unifying movement in the communities served by IGA.
